Output fddfb751a742af96939a2359323a2d9e0e1b5b4bb990e7ae62fe59710e1423b9:2

value
10821257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ff8c3890875b175f69779369fc6b98e98c700638 OP_EQUAL
address
3QzEDBaqVwb3wjDPekWaKMW2v9BywdNFAe
transaction
fddfb751a742af96939a2359323a2d9e0e1b5b4bb990e7ae62fe59710e1423b9
spent
true